In the northern Iraqi city of Erbil, Christians gather for Christmas Mass.<br/> <br />They prayed for peace and the return of stability after a decade of violence in their country.<br/> <br />(SOUNDBITE) (Arabic) IRAQI CHRISTIAN CITIZEN, ESSAM ISTEFAN, SAYING:<br/> <br />"I wish on Christmas Day happiness for Christians in Iraq and around the world, and I wish that the Iraqi people can overcome these difficult times, and I hope for the return of happiness and peace in the country."<br/> <br />In the capitol Baghdad, the same prayer...peace in a nation stained with sectarian violence.<br/> <br />(SOUNDBITE) (Arabic) IRAQI CHRISTIAN CITIZEN, HADEEL, SAYING:<br/> <br />"I hope that this Christmas will be a time for peace, for the Muslims and Christians alike.
